  18. Made a list of all the Descendents records I know of. Thought maybe it could help some of you guys or you could help me add more releases that aren't already added. I got the info from sites like discogs, how's your edge and Descendents collectors websites. 12" Milo Goes to College: - 1st Press [1982] (New Alliance) BLACK (New Alliance address on back cover) (Small quantity of this press came with lyric sheet/insert included) - 2nd Press [1990] (SST) ---- GREY [Limited "Colored Vinyl" variant] ---- BLACK I Don't Want to Grow Up - 1st Press [1985] (New Alliance) BLACK - 2nd Press [1990] (SST) ---- RED [Limited "Colored Vinyl" variant] ---- BLACK Bonus Fat - 1st Press [1985] (New Alliance) BLACK - 2nd Press (SST) GREY, GREEN, BROWN, PURPLE Enjoy! - 1st Press [1986] (New Alliance/Restless) BLACK - 2nd Press [1990] ---- WHITE [Limited "Colored Vinyl" variant] ---- PINK [Limited "Colored Vinyl" variant] ---- BLACK - (Enigma Europe) BLACK ALL - 1st Press [1987] (SST) BLACK (with tour flyer/band photo insert) - 2nd Press [1990] ---- BLUE [Limited "Colored Vinyl" variant] (with tour flyer/band photo insert) ---- GREY [Limited "Colored Vinyl" variant] (with tour flyer/band photo insert) ---- Current pressing (SST) BLACK, PURPLE, BROWN, GREY Liveage - 1st Press [1987] (SST) BLACK - PROMO (SST) BLACK (with glossy band photo inserts) - 2nd Press [1990] (SST) BLUE [Limited "Colored Vinyl" variant] Hallraker - 1st Press [1989] (SST) BLACK - PROMO (SST) BLACK (includes photocopy/press packet) - 2nd Press [1990] (SST) GREEN [Limited "Colored Vinyl" variant] Somery - 1st Press [1991] (SST) BLACK (2x LP) Everything Sucks - 1st Press [1996] (Epitaph) BLACK - 2nd Press [2010] (Epitaph) ---- WHITE (/500) ---- BLACK - 3rd Press [2010] (Epitaph) ---- CLEAR (/500) ---- BLUE (/600) Cool to Be You - 1st Press [2004] (Fat Wreck Chords) ---- BLUE (/197) ---- BLACK 7" Ride the Wild / It's a Hectic World - 1st variant (Orca/pacific) BLACK (re-pressed multiple times) (thick paper sleeve) - 2nd variant (Pinsicato) BLACK (re-press from mid 80's) (Pinsicato records on front of sleeve) (thinner paper sleeve) - 3rd variant (Orca/Pacific) BLACK ("Recorded in 1979" version) (thinner paper sleeve) FAT EP (New Alliance) BLACK Enjoy promo 7" (New Alliance) BLACK Clean Sheets/Coolidge promo (SST) BLACK When I Get Old (Epitaph) GREY I'm the One (Epitaph) BLUE Gotta (Sessions) BLACK 'Merican - (Fat) BLACK - (Fat) RED (/552) - (Fat) WHITE (/233) - (Fat) BLUE (/213) - (Fat) BLUE & WHITE SWIRL (transition colour)
